I thought it was a good game. EP outshot AHA 2 -1. The shots were like 51 - 26....
First period was pretty tight with the exception of the shots. AHA had many chances to take a lead, EP had a 4 on 1 at one point and did not score. Period ended at 0 - 0.
Second period EP got two quick ones, I missed then, I had to sharpen someones skates. Then AHA got one back. EP came back down and scored it right back then added two more before the end of the period. 5-2 after two.
Third period, when all hope seemed to stop, the Stars came out. got to 5 - 4. AHA pulled their goalie and EP got an empty-netter. But AHA came back down and got one back.
Although EP outshot them, AHA kept fighting and getting their chances.
AHA got a major in the second and only gave up one goal and also killed off a 5 on 3.
There was a lot of hitting out there and some tempers flared, but a fun game. I have to say the intensity by AHA was the best I have seen in three years. People may disagree with me....
